المعنى الاصطلاحي :


Saying ‘amen’ at the end of a supplication made by another person.

الشرح المختصر :


"Ta’meen-ud-du‘ā’" (saying ‘amen’) is one of the verbal ethics and acts of worship a person ought to observe upon hearing or reciting a supplication made by someone else regardless of whether the supplication is made for the supplicant, the hearer, or both of them. ‘Amen’ is a word used at the end of supplications inside the prayer or outside of it, as the believer asks Allah, the Almighty, to answer his invocations. It is the imperative form of "ta’meen", meaning: O Allah, answer the supplication.
